Identify Common Causes of Weak Airflow in Your Car’s HVAC

Weak airflow in your car’s HVAC system can be frustrating, especially during extreme weather conditions. Understanding the common causes can help you address the issue effectively.

One primary cause of weak airflow is a clogged cabin air filter. This filter traps dust, pollen, and other debris, preventing clean air from circulating. Regular replacement can ensure adequate airflow through the AC system.

Another issue might be related to the blower motor. If the motor is failing or has a reduced power output, it cannot push air effectively through the system. Testing the blower motor can reveal if it’s functioning as it should.

Duct obstructions can also lead to weak airflow. Items stored in the wrong places can block air ducts, as can accumulated debris. Inspecting and clearing the ducts will improve air distribution inside the cabin.

Leakage in the HVAC system can result in decreased airflow. Over time, hoses and seals can wear out, allowing conditioned air to escape before reaching the cabin. Checking for leaks and repairing them can enhance both airflow and overall efficiency.

Lastly, issues with the AC compressor can lead to weak airflow. If the compressor is not engaging properly, it may not generate enough cool air. Ensuring the compressor is in good working order is crucial for maintaining strong airflow.

Step-by-Step Guide to Clean and Repair Your Car’s AC Components

The functionality of your car’s AC system is crucial for optimal airflow and comfort. If you experience weak airflow, it may be time to clean and repair the AC components. Follow this step-by-step guide to effectively address your vehicle’s AC issues.

First, ensure your vehicle is parked in a safe area and turn off the engine. Start by locating the cabin air filter, which is typically found behind the glove compartment or under the dashboard. Remove the filter and inspect it for dirt and debris. If it appears clogged, replace it with a new one to enhance airflow.

Next, check the AC evaporator and condenser. These components can accumulate dust and debris over time, affecting their efficiency. Use a soft brush and a vacuum cleaner to gently clean the surfaces. Be cautious not to damage any fins during the process.

After cleaning the exterior components, inspect the AC drain line for blockages. A clogged drain can cause water to back up, leading to reduced airflow. Use a flexible wire to carefully remove any obstructions from the drain line.

Proceed to check the AC compressor for any signs of wear or damage. If you notice any issues, such as unusual noises or leaks, it may require professional repair. If the compressor is functioning well, ensure all electrical connections are secure and free from corrosion.

Finally, recharge your AC system if necessary. Use a refrigerant recharge kit, following the instructions provided. Ensure the proper quantity of refrigerant is added to maintain optimal performance and airflow.

By following these steps, you can effectively clean and repair your car’s AC components, ultimately fixing weak airflow issues and ensuring a comfortable driving experience.

When to Seek Professional Help for HVAC Problems

Identifying when to seek professional help for HVAC issues is crucial to maintaining optimal performance in your car’s climate control system. Here are some key indicators that suggest it’s time to consult an expert:

  • Persistent Weak Airflow: If you’ve attempted to fix weak airflow issues and noticed no significant improvement, it’s essential to get professional assistance. A qualified technician can diagnose underlying problems such as clogged ductwork or a malfunctioning blower motor.
  • Unusual Noises: Sounds like rattling, grinding, or whistling while the AC is running can signal mechanical problems. These noises could indicate failing components that need to be inspected or replaced by a professional.
  • Unpleasant Odors: If your HVAC system is emitting foul smells, it could indicate mold or mildew buildup in the ventilation system. Professionals can perform the necessary cleaning and sanitization to ensure safe airflow.
  • Inconsistent Temperatures: If the temperature inside your vehicle varies dramatically, even when the AC is set to a specific level, this inconsistency warrants a professional diagnostic to identify and fix issues with the HVAC system.
  • Coolant Leaks: If you notice any fluid leaks beneath your car, particularly refrigerant, it’s critical to seek professional help. Low refrigerant levels can affect airflow and overall AC performance.
  • Frequent System Cycling: If your AC frequently turns on and off without reaching the desired temperature, it could indicate a larger issue, such as a malfunctioning thermostat or pressure imbalance. A technician can pinpoint the issue and advise on repairs.

Taking prompt action when you notice these problems can prevent further damage to your HVAC system. Regular professional maintenance can also help ensure that your car’s airflow is always at its best, reducing the chances of future issues.
